The Europe foam tape market is witnessing steady growth driven by diverse applications across building and construction, automotive, electrical and electronics, and industrial sectors, supported by a strong emphasis on quality, sustainability, and innovation. Foam tapes are versatile adhesive solutions available in various products including acrylic foam tapes, rubber based foam tapes, and silicone foam tapes, each tailored to specific performance requirements such as bonding strength, weather resistance, and vibration damping. Acrylic foam tapes are widely preferred for their excellent durability and resistance to UV and temperature variations, making them suitable for exterior applications in construction and automotive assembly. Rubber based options offer good initial tack and flexibility, which are valuable in general purpose sealing and mounting tasks. Silicone based foam tapes serve niche high temperature and specialized applications. Double-sided foam tapes dominate and grow fastest in the Europe foam tape market because they offer superior bonding versatility and ease of application across multiple substrates and industries. Double-sided foam tapes dominate and grow fastest in the Europe foam tape market because they provide unmatched convenience and performance for bonding, mounting, and sealing applications across diverse industrial and commercial sectors. Unlike single-sided tapes, double-sided options allow two surfaces to be joined seamlessly without visible adhesive, which is highly valued in construction, automotive, electronics, and signage industries where aesthetics and clean finishes are important. They are particularly effective for mounting panels, decorative elements, or electronic components, as they distribute stress evenly and absorb vibration, reducing the risk of material damage. The versatility of double-sided foam tapes extends to various substrate types including metals, plastics, glass, and composites, making them suitable for a wide range of applications where single-sided tapes may fall short. In addition, they simplify installation processes, reduce labor time, and eliminate the need for mechanical fasteners, which lowers project costs and enhances efficiency. Their compatibility with high performance foam cores and advanced adhesives ensures strong adhesion, long-term durability, and resistance to environmental factors such as moisture, temperature variations, and UV exposure. Regulatory and environmental standards in Europe have also encouraged the development of low emission and eco-friendly double-sided tapes, increasing their appeal in markets that prioritize sustainability. Growth in construction, automotive, and electronics sectors, along with rising demand for energy efficient and lightweight solutions, continues to drive adoption. As manufacturers innovate with improved tack, peel strength, and foam formulations, double-sided foam tapes are expected to maintain their leadership position as the preferred type segment, offering a combination of performance, convenience, and versatility unmatched by single-sided alternatives. Acrylic foam tapes are fastest growing due to their superior adhesion, durability, and resistance to extreme environmental conditions. Acrylic foam tapes lead growth in the Europe foam tape market because they provide a unique combination of performance, reliability, and versatility that meets the stringent demands of multiple industries including construction, automotive, electronics, and industrial manufacturing. Acrylic foam adhesives offer excellent bonding strength on a wide variety of substrates such as metals, glass, plastics, and composites, making them highly adaptable for applications that require durable and long lasting adhesion. Their resistance to UV light, temperature fluctuations, moisture, and chemicals ensures stable performance in both indoor and outdoor environments, which is increasingly important given the rigorous standards for building materials, automotive assembly, and electronic device manufacturing in Europe. Compared to other foam types like polyurethane, polyethylene, and neoprene, acrylic foams provide superior structural integrity, maintaining bond strength over long periods even under stress or vibration. Regulatory and environmental considerations in Europe have also accelerated the adoption of acrylic foam tapes, as they can be formulated to comply with low emission requirements and sustainable building practices, offering an eco-friendly alternative without compromising performance. The versatility of acrylic foam tapes allows them to be used in mounting, sealing, cushioning, and insulating applications, which supports demand from growing sectors such as infrastructure development, electric vehicles, and advanced electronics. Manufacturers are investing in research and development to enhance tack, peel strength, and foam density, creating innovative products that meet evolving market needs. Rising awareness among end users about durability, energy efficiency, and aesthetic appeal further drives the preference for acrylic foam tapes. Silicone resin foam tapes are fastest growing due to their exceptional temperature resistance and chemical stability for specialized applications. Silicone resin has emerged as the fastest growing segment in the Europe foam tape market because it offers unique properties that address demanding industrial and commercial requirements where other resins such as acrylic, rubber, or ethylene vinyl acetate may fall short. Silicone based foam tapes provide excellent adhesion across a wide range of substrates while maintaining their structural integrity under extreme temperatures, both high and low, making them ideal for applications in automotive, aerospace, electronics, and industrial manufacturing. Their superior resistance to UV radiation, moisture, chemicals, and aging ensures long term durability and reliability even in harsh environmental conditions, which is increasingly important for compliance with European regulatory standards and industry performance expectations. Compared to acrylic or rubber based tapes, silicone foams can withstand continuous exposure to heat and mechanical stress without losing adhesion or flexibility, which expands their use in high performance sealing, gasketing, and insulation applications. The growing demand for electric vehicles, energy efficient building materials, and advanced electronics has further accelerated adoption of silicone foam tapes, as they provide thermal management and cushioning solutions that enhance safety and longevity. Manufacturers are also innovating with customized silicone formulations to improve tack, peel strength, and foam density while ensuring low emission and environmentally friendly profiles to meet European sustainability standards. Additionally, the versatility of silicone foams in bonding diverse materials such as metals, glass, and plastics allows end users to achieve both functional and aesthetic requirements. As industries increasingly seek high performance, durable, and specialized adhesive solutions, silicone resin foam tapes are poised to maintain strong growth. Water based foam tapes are fastest growing due to their eco friendliness and compliance with stringent European environmental regulations. Water based adhesive technology is witnessing rapid growth in the Europe foam tape market because it offers a sustainable alternative to traditional solvent based and hot melt adhesives without compromising performance for many applications. These adhesives use water as the primary carrier instead of volatile organic compounds, significantly reducing emissions and environmental impact, which aligns with strict European Union regulations on chemical safety, low VOC content, and workplace health standards. As industries increasingly prioritize green building practices, energy efficient construction, and environmentally responsible manufacturing, water based foam tapes are becoming the preferred choice for applications such as sealing, mounting, insulation, and vibration damping across construction, automotive, and electronics sectors. Compared to solvent based tapes, water based options are safer to handle, minimize fire hazards, and simplify disposal, which reduces operational costs and regulatory compliance burdens for manufacturers and end users. Hot melt based tapes, while fast setting, often lack the environmental benefits and long term stability offered by water based systems in certain temperature and moisture conditions. The versatility of water based foam tapes allows them to bond a wide range of substrates including metals, plastics, glass, and composites, while innovations in adhesive formulations continue to improve tack, peel strength, and weather resistance to meet industrial standards. Additionally, the shift towards circular economy principles and sustainability initiatives in Europe encourages manufacturers to invest in water based adhesive technologies, further driving market adoption. Rising awareness among end users about environmentally friendly products and regulatory pressure to reduce hazardous chemical use ensures that water based foam tapes will maintain their position as the fastest growing technology segment in Europe. The electrical and electronics segment is fastest growing due to rising demand for lightweight, compact, and high performance bonding and insulation solutions. The electrical and electronics sector is the fastest growing end-user segment in the Europe foam tape market because foam tapes provide critical functions such as insulation, cushioning, vibration damping, thermal management, and secure mounting of components in a wide range of devices and systems. With the rapid advancement of consumer electronics, industrial automation, and smart devices, manufacturers require reliable and durable adhesive solutions that maintain performance under heat, moisture, and mechanical stress. Foam tapes offer excellent compatibility with diverse substrates including metals, plastics, glass, and composites, which allows manufacturers to assemble compact and lightweight devices without compromising structural integrity or functionality. Regulatory standards in Europe concerning electrical safety, emissions, and environmental compliance further drive the preference for high quality foam tapes that meet performance and sustainability requirements. Compared to automotive and building applications, which often rely on larger scale or mechanical assembly methods, electronics applications demand precise and consistent adhesion, making foam tapes indispensable for modern product designs. Additionally, the growing adoption of electric vehicles, renewable energy systems, and connected smart devices is increasing the need for specialized foam tapes that can manage heat, vibration, and electrical insulation while contributing to energy efficiency and miniaturization. Manufacturers are investing in research and development to enhance foam density, adhesive formulations, and thermal conductivity, allowing tapes to meet evolving technological demands. The combination of regulatory compliance, performance reliability, and compatibility with advanced electronics ensures strong growth for this segment, positioning electrical and electronics as the fastest expanding end-user category in the Europe foam tape market and creating opportunities for further innovation and adoption across emerging technologies and smart applications.
